    Nottingham Post published London Scottish 17 Nottingham Rugby 18: Match report
    Nottingham Rugby looked to have thrown away a 15-0 lead at London Scottish only for Dan Mugford to come to the rescue with a last-minute drop goal in an 18-17 league win.Nottingham took the lead after just three minutes at the Athletic Ground, fly-halfMugford kicking a penalty from 40 metres.The visitors kept up the pressure in the Scottish half and, after Josh Thomas Brown was sent to the sin bin for the hosts, the Greens made a driving maul count as No.8 Paul Grant went over on 14 minutes...

    EllieCullen published Hate crimes up by nearly 20 per cent in Nottinghamshire
    Hate crimes rocketed by 20 per cent in the last year in Nottinghamshire.There were a total of 832 offences of verbal abuse, intimidation and physical attacks on people because of the colour of their skin, their religion, disability or sexuality in 2014-15.This compares to 696 the previous year and means there are now more than two reported incidents every day in the county.The figures have been released this week to mark national hate crime week, which ends on Saturday – to raise awareness

  • TomNorton published Erewash Borough Council axes use of allegedly toxic weed killer

    TomNorton published Erewash Borough Council axes use of  allegedly toxic weed killer
    A local authority has stopped its use of a type of weed killer believed to be toxic. Erewash Borough Council has made the step to using glyphosate weed killers using polyethoxylated tallow amines, or tallow, which some evidence suggests is toxic to human cells and amphibious wildlife.The authority said while glyphosate weedkillers are still permitted for use in the UK it had concerns over products with the tallow element in them.Tallow is a surfactant, used to assist in delivering chemicals into

    Barry_Cooper published Why pet 'head pressing' could be a sign of a serious illness
    It isn't unusual to see your animal doing strange things, many of which may make you laugh.But could they be hiding something far more sinister? What may appear to be just an animal rubbing its head against a wall, could actually signify a potentially fatal illness that requires immediate medical attention. A condition known as head pressing is when animals, predominantly dogs and cats, press their head against firm objects, such as a wall or door, for prolonged periods of time.
